Smiles One Family Six Times Within Three Years.
A remarkable case of family affliction comes before the public today in the death of Miss Anna Ball, which occurred at the residence of her mother, Mrs. J. Ball last night. Miss Ball had been afflicted with consumption for over a year and she died at the untimely age of 16 years and nine months. She was a sister of the late Minnie Ball who died July 8, last, also at an early age and in the midst of a beautiful christian work. The deceased was a young lady of amiable disposition and possessed a host of friends who will extend the tenderest sympathy the bereaved mother in her awful affliction. This death is the sixth that Mrs. Ball has been called upon to mourn in her immediate family within the space of three years, and the sorrow has indeed been heavy. The funeral will occur Friday afternoon at 2:30 o'clock from the Second Reformed church. Kalamazoo Daily Telegraph August 20, 1890 page 7
